Vince Macri Reassigned To Atlantic City

April 16, 2005 - American Hockey League (AHL)
Bridgeport Islanders News Release


BRIDGEPORT, CT – The American Hockey League's Bridgeport Sound Tigers, top affiliate of the National Hockey League's New York Islanders, have announced the reassignment of defenseman Vince Macri to their ECHL affiliate, the Atlantic City Boardwalk Bullies.

Macri has one goal and four penalty minutes in 27 AHL games with the Sound Tigers and five goals, nine assists, 14 points and 99 penalty minutes in 49 ECHL games with Atlantic City this season.
